[The value of dobutamine in cardiology]

Dobutamine significantly improves cardiac function and reduces vascular resistance in patients with low output syndrome and left ventricular failure. Its hemodynamic benefits support its use in acute myocardial infarction and other cardiac conditions.

Background:

  • Low output syndrome and left ventricular failure present significant clinical challenges.
  • Dobutamine is a sympathomimetic amine used to treat cardiac dysfunction.

Purpose of the Study:

  • To evaluate the hemodynamic effects of dobutamine in patients with low output syndrome.
  • To assess the safety and efficacy of dobutamine for prolonged use and in acute myocardial infarction.

Main Methods:

  • Hemodynamic parameters were assessed via cardiac catheterization in 17 patients.
  • Nine patients received prolonged treatment with dobutamine at 8 microgram/kg/min.
  • Continuous monitoring included arterial pressure, heart rate, and cardiac output.

Main Results:

  • Dobutamine significantly increased cardiac index, systolic index, myocardial contractility (dp/dt, Vmax), and systolic work index.
  • Mean aortic pressure and heart rate showed minimal increases.
  • Left ventricular end-diastolic pressure, systemic, and pulmonary vascular resistance significantly decreased.
  • Hemodynamic improvements were consistent in both short-term and prolonged treatment groups.

Conclusions:

  • Dobutamine is effective in improving hemodynamic function in low output syndromes with left ventricular failure, regardless of etiology.
  • The drug's favorable hemodynamic profile and minimal impact on myocardial excitability suggest its utility in acute myocardial infarction.
  • Dobutamine may be considered for prolonged use in managing severe heart failure and cardiogenic shock.
